(This is actually more an issue instead of a PR, but since I have a failing test, I figured I'd post this as a PR anyway.)
When
metais used as attribute name,PATCHrequests are failing because the attribute's value is used in a code path which is supposed to handle the top-levelmetaproperty.Request body (taken from the test case):
Exception:
I didn't find any note that
metashould not be used as attribute name. If that actually is advised, it would be great to check the models and throw an Error if a model/serializer with ametaproperty is found.
